| Name | 1-(3-bromophenyl)propan-1-one |
|---|---|
| Synonyms |
MFCD00000084
1-(3-Bromophenyl)-1-propanone 1-(3-bromophenyl)propan-1-one 1-Propanone, 1-(3-bromophenyl)- 3'-bromoacetophenone 3'-Bromopropiophenone EINECS 243-353-8 3-Bromophenyl Ethyl Ketone 3-Bromopropiophenone m-Bromopropiophenone |
| Density | 1.4±0.1 g/cm3 |
|---|---|
| Boiling Point | 271.0±23.0 °C at 760 mmHg |
| Melting Point | 39-41 °C(lit.) |
| Molecular Formula | C9H9BrO |
| Molecular Weight | 213.071 |
| Flash Point | 79.6±9.9 °C |
| Exact Mass | 211.983673 |
| PSA | 17.07000 |
| LogP | 3.11 |
| Vapour Pressure | 0.0±0.6 mmHg at 25°C |
| Index of Refraction | 1.545 |
